WebMyocardial involvement during viral infection is underestimated (∼5%). Most infections are not perceived and resolve spontaneously. Symptoms may be non-specific, but include new onset of angina in a young athlete, chest pain, increased resting and exercise heart rate, increased dyspnoea, palpitations, syncope, and impairment of exercise capacity.
